The Meinl Percussion Jam Cajon Box Drum is an excellent choice for anyone looking to dive into the world of percussion, whether you're a beginner or a more experienced player. Its strengths lie in its user-friendly design; you can start playing it with just a few taps using your hands, making it accessible for all skill levels. The construction from 100% Baltic birch wood not only provides durability but also enhances its sound quality, akin to that of high-end drum sets. The two sets of steel snare wires deliver sharp, snappy tones, while a rear sound port helps in projecting sound and can double as a mic placement for performances, which is great for acoustic settings or jam sessions with friends.
The AKLOT Cajon Drum Box is made from Baltic birch wood, which is known for its durability and ability to produce clear, punchy bass tones. This material choice is a significant strength as it is commonly used in high-end drums. The compact size (10x10x14 inches) makes it portable and easier to carry, which is perfect for musicians on the go. The included gig bag provides extra convenience and protection during transport.
The Meinl Subwoofer Bass Cajon Box Drum features a distinctive American White Ash playing surface that delivers a warm and punchy sound, paired with a modern composite body that helps reflect sound clearly. Its size (11.75” W x 19.75” H x 12.75” D) and weight (11 pounds) make it a manageable option for transport and use in various settings like acoustic gigs, worship music, and recording sessions.
